Why Leg Compression Sleeve For Swelling Is Necessary
From my experience, wearing a leg compression sleeve has made a huge difference in managing swelling. When my legs started feeling heavy and puffy, especially after long days of standing or sitting, the compression sleeve helped improve blood circulation. This boost in circulation reduced the buildup of fluid, which is often the main cause of swelling.
I also noticed that the gentle pressure from the sleeve provided support to my muscles and veins, preventing them from overworking and becoming fatigued. This not only eased the discomfort but also helped me stay more active throughout the day without feeling weighed down.
Moreover, using a leg compression sleeve gave me peace of mind, knowing that I was taking a proactive step to prevent further swelling or complications like varicose veins. For anyone struggling with leg swelling, I’d say it’s a simple, effective tool that can make daily life much more comfortable.

Choosing the Right Compression Level
Compression sleeves come in different pressure levels, usually measured in mmHg. I found that:
- Mild compression (8-15 mmHg) is good for minor swelling and prevention.
- Moderate compression (15-20 mmHg) works well for moderate swelling and varicose veins.
- Firm compression (20-30 mmHg and above) is for more serious swelling or medical conditions and often requires a doctor’s recommendation.
I opted for moderate compression because it balanced comfort and effectiveness for my swelling.
Getting the Perfect Fit
Sizing is crucial. I measured my calf circumference and leg length as directed by the brand’s sizing chart. A sleeve that’s too tight felt uncomfortable and could worsen swelling, while one too loose didn’t provide enough support. Taking accurate measurements made a big difference in comfort.
Material and Breathability
Since I wear my compression sleeve for many hours, I looked for breathable, moisture-wicking materials. This helped keep my skin dry and prevented irritation. I preferred sleeves made with nylon and spandex blends for stretch and durability.
Ease of Use and Comfort
Putting on compression sleeves can be tricky, especially if they are very tight. I chose a sleeve with a non-slip top band to prevent it from sliding down throughout the day. Also, seamless designs helped avoid chafing.

When to Consult a Healthcare Professional
If your swelling is severe or persistent, I recommend seeing a doctor before buying a sleeve. Sometimes, medical-grade compression or other treatments are necessary. I made sure to get professional advice when my swelling didn’t improve.
